1717 Abigail French was born on 5 of month 7. [1]
1737 Abigail French and James Lewis were married 1736/37 on 3 of month 1 [March]. [2] [3]
1741 The husband of Abigail French, James Lewis, Bordentown, Burlington County, New Jersey, will dated 8 Feb 1741, proved 28 Mar 1741. [4]
Abigail French married, second, Jacob Taylor. [5]
1745 The will of Richard French named daughter Abigail, wife of Jacob Taylor. [6]
1745 Jacob Taylor, the husband of Abigail French, was a freeholder in Chesterfield Township, Burlington County, New Jersey. Dated April 15. [7]
